A special thank you to the 32 community volunteers who came together to create this video by reciting a segment of Dr. King's "I Have a Dream" speech.

The focus of this event was to bring the community together by reminding of us of Dr. King’s dream. Through this video we can share his dream in a way that can teach others around us. When that happens, we truly LIVE UNITED.
